Are there any work placement opportunities included in the Rqf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management part time?

Yes, the Rqf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management part time program offers work placement opportunities to students. Work placements are a valuable component of the course as they provide students with real-world experience and the opportunity to apply their theoretical knowledge in a practical setting.

During the work placement, students will have the chance to work in a business or management role, gaining hands-on experience and developing key skills that are essential for success in the industry. This practical experience is invaluable for students looking to kickstart their careers in business and management.

Work placements are typically arranged by the course provider, who will work closely with students to find a placement that aligns with their interests and career goals. Students may have the opportunity to work in a variety of settings, from small businesses to multinational corporations, giving them a well-rounded view of the industry.

Some of the key benefits of work placements include:

Hands-on experience Networking opportunities Skill development
Students will gain practical experience in a real-world business environment, allowing them to apply their knowledge and skills in a professional setting. Work placements provide students with the opportunity to network with industry professionals, potentially leading to future job opportunities. Students will develop key skills such as communication, teamwork, problem-solving, and time management, which are essential for success in the business and management field.

Overall, work placements are a valuable component of the Rqf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management part time program, providing students with the opportunity to gain practical experience, develop key skills, and network with industry professionals.
